Question: I enthusiastically read that The Shield's fifth season has been extended by eight episodes for a total of 21. Is that because they needed more episodes to wrap up the series for good, or is it an omen for more seasons of possibly the best show on TV?Answer: I'm leaning towards your first theory, especially in light of what series creator Shawn Ryan told me last week. "I'm ready to turn the corner and head for a finish line," he said. "Whether that takes just these [21] episodes, whether it takes some more, I'm not exactly sure yet. I think FX will accommodate me whenever I think I want the ending to be. But there's a light at the end of the tunnel." Ryan added that a decision will likely be made before the fifth season kicks off in January.

Question: You've answered a lot of questions about Vaughn and Alias but not this one: Did Michael Vartan elect to leave, or was he fired?Answer: Well, as you might expect, it's complicated. Here's what I've been told from a reliable source close to the situation. Shortly after Vartan and J.Ga's big split, Vartan allegedly made it known that he wouldn't be terribly upset if Vaughn were to get whacked while on assignment. TPTB, in turn, made it known that Vartan had a contract to honor and, well, he better suck it up and be a professional. Cut to 2005: Producers, looking for a way to revitalize the show and give Sydney a personal mission in Alias' final season, finally granted Vartan his wish.
